The Sky's 23 turnovers are the most turnovers since June 17 where they had 25 turnovers against the Washington Mystics.
Final Sky Team Stats: 68 PTS 24-61 FG (39.3%) 7-16 3FG (43.8%) 13-16 FT (81.3%) 36 REBS 12 ASTS 28 PITP 7 FBPS 23 TOs that MIN turned into 20 PTs
Final Sky Stats (1/2): Nurse: 16 pts, 8 rebs, 1 ast, 1 stl Reese: 11 pts, 11 rebs, 3 asts, 1 blk Cardoso: 10 pts, 10 rebs, 2 asts, 1 stl Westbeld: 9 pts, 1 reb
Final Sky Stats (2/2): Banham: 8 pts, 1 reb HVL: 7 pts, 2 rebs, 4 asts, 3 stls Williams: 4 pts, 1 reb, 1 ast, 1 stl, 1 blk Allen: 3 pts, 2 rebs, 1 ast
The Sky pick up their 16th loss of the season, falling to the Minnesota Lynx, 91-68. Next up: Chicago welcomes in the Seattle Storm on Thursday night.
